Output 95da336289622a40ddd45f4abac93ffb8be31f26ba25f661c4f5c61d9514e2fb:0

value
2580
script pubkey
OP_0 OP_PUSHBYTES_20 eb68edfe65850cb75b555ced2f687bb02b8bfbba
address
bc1qad5wmln9s5xtwk64tnkj76rmkq4ch7a6u9mhf9
transaction
95da336289622a40ddd45f4abac93ffb8be31f26ba25f661c4f5c61d9514e2fb
spent
true